A Bottle Share is when Craft Beer enthusiasts and/or people new to Craft Beer get together and bring a unique and special beers to share. My first bottle share took place before I moved to Austin in New Jersey about 3 years ago hosted by Mike from New Jersey Craft Beer.  I didn’t know there were any rules/etiquette to follow. Firkin Tappings Thursday at Banger’s Sausage House & Beer: One-of-a-Kind Casks from Range of Craft Brewers Firkin tappings every Thursday, Banger’s taps firkins from various craft brewers. Guests can try beers infused with unexpected flavors such as fruits, herbs and spices. On January 29th, Banger’s will tap Prairie Artisan Birra of Oklahoma, flavored with ginger.
